These fluffy pumpkin sage dinner rolls are perfect for any occasion!
Ingredients
Scale
- 3 cups all-purpose flour
- 1 packet (2 ¼ tsp) instant yeast
- 2 tbsp brown sugar
- 1 tsp salt
- 1 cup warm milk (about 110°F)
- 4 tbsp unsalted butter, melted
- 1 cup pumpkin puree
- ¼ cup fresh sage leaves, finely chopped
Instructions
- In a large bowl, combine flour, yeast, brown sugar, and salt.
- In another bowl, whisk together warm milk, melted butter, and pumpkin puree until smooth. Pour into the dry ingredients.
- Fold in chopped sage leaves until evenly mixed.
- Knead the dough on a floured surface for about 8-10 minutes until smooth and elastic.
- Place the dough in a greased bowl, cover with a damp cloth, and let rise in a warm area for about an hour or until doubled in size.
- Punch down the risen dough and divide it into golf ball-sized portions. Arrange on a greased baking tray.
-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C) and bake for 20-25 minutes until golden brown.
Notes
- Make sure the milk is warm, but not too hot, to ensure the yeast activates properly.
- These rolls can be served warm or at room temperature.
